    A treadmill under your desk can help you be active while working. Walking while working can help you burn calories and increase productivity. It's not a substitute for a sweaty session at the gym.

    This under-desk treadmill is affordable and offers various features that track your progress. It's easy to use and has sleek design that can fit under your desk or in a closet when it's not in use.

    The optimal walking speed

    You can increase your overall calorie burning by incorporating physical activity into your work routine. This can assist you in achieving your fitness goals. Making time to exercise each day can be a challenge. This is true, especially if your career or other obligations make it difficult for you to take a break to exercise. That's why treadmills under desks are a great option to keep you in shape while working at your home or in the office. These small, compact and quiet machines allow you to walk or jog as you work.

    When selecting an under desk treadmill with incline treadmill, think about how much space you'll have to work in. Models that fold up or have wheels could save space. Some models even allow you to adjust the height, so you can tuck them under furniture. Some under desk treadmills also have LED screens that show calories as well as distance and speed, although they can be a bit distracting when used at full capacity.

    The tiniest and most affordable under-desk treadmill we tested the Goplus Walking Treadmill, is made for people who don't have lots of space. It's easy to use and has a compact footprint. This machine under your desk is not for all users. It is limited in its range of speeds, no inclined feature, and it can be jerky to change speeds.

    This compact, sturdy portable treadmill with incline from Maksone comes with an adjustable speed setting, and is adored by reviewers on the internet for its quiet motor. It also comes with an anti-slip belt as well as large, clear display that is easy to read while working. It can also be folded and wheeled away after you've finished your walk.

    If you're new to using an under-desk treadmill by doing 15 minutes of fast walking every day to check how your body reacts to it. You can gradually increase the duration of your walks. Try to do two sessions of 20 minutes during the week in order to get your desired calories.

    The optimal incline

    Walking is a great method to keep fit while at work. It can reduce blood pressure, insulin levels, and help boost your immune system. It also helps with digestion. It also helps to strengthen your muscles, and may even generate more calories than other exercises. Under-desk treadmills can help boost the intensity of your workout by altering the electric incline treadmill. Additionally, they can fit under your desk and minimize noise and vibrations.

    The Goplus under-desk treadmill is easy to use and features simple LED displays that shows the time and distance, speed and calories burned. Its small size makes it easy to stow away and slide under your desk, and the shock absorption minimizes the sound and vibration. The model isn't built to last and the belt frayed after a few weeks of usage. The life of the belt was diminished however, not due to human error. The treadmill's one-year guarantee does not cover normal wear and tears Therefore, it is advisable to purchase the treadmill that lasts longer.

    Another factor to consider when selecting an under-desk treadmill is its stability and weight capacity. Most of these units aren't designed to hold as much weight as traditional treadmills, so they're ideal for those who aren't heavy. However, you can find a few models that can accommodate up to 220 pounds. It's essential to check the machine's max weight capacity before purchasing, since carrying too much weight can cause damage to the machine and decrease its lifespan.

    Another benefit of treadmills under desks is that they're easy to set up. They're often equipped with wheels, which means you can move them around the office when they're not in use. They can be folded up and put under your desk. They're also extremely quiet, meaning you can walk around during Zoom meetings or other phone calls without disturbing your coworkers. The only issue is that the majority of treadmills that are under desks do not include an app to track your progress. There are apps that will track your fitness progress whether you're at work or at home.

    Safety features

    It is easy to work out while working on a treadmill under your desk. To avoid accidents, you must be aware of all the safety features that come with these machines. Also, be aware of the amount of time you spend on these machines as too many walks can adversely affect your health. The best method to avoid injuries when using a treadmill under your desk is to speak with an expert about your health and fitness goals.

    The treadmill that sits under your desk from LifeSpan has several safety features that help you stay on track while working. Its Intelli-Step technology tracks your steps and keeps you up-to-date on the total number of calories burned throughout the day. It can be programmed to shut down after a predetermined amount of time, turn off alerts or beeps, return to its previous speed and change measurement units. This treadmill can be linked to your fitness program to record your walk data.

    The motor of this treadmill under the desk is quiet enough to be used in the Zoom meeting. In fact, GGR staff writer Lauren Strong utilizes it in her 900-square-foot house with a toddler and husband and hasn't seen the motor turn on or off. She walks on the treadmill, listening to podcasts or ad-free songs.

    In contrast to traditional treadmills, under-desk treadmills typically have smaller, less powerful motors, making them easier to move and store. It is also important to be aware of the weight of those who will be using it.

    A quality under-desk treadmill must be strong, with handrails that fold down to provide additional stability. Some come with a telescoping bars for greater comfort and support. It is important to be aware of the dimensions of the walking deck, as this will determine how comfortably you can walk on it. Some models come with a track length that can reach 70 inches, which could be useful if you intend to run in addition to walk.

    Pick a model that features an ergonomically-designed console and an LCD that is easy to read. It should be simple to adjust the speed as you work and include a remote control. It should also be able to automatically shut off if there is no one on it for a period of 5 seconds. This will help prevent overheating and lower the chance of injury.

    User-friendliness

    If you are looking for a treadmill that can let you walk, run or even light jog while you work, the UREVO under-desk treadmill may be perfect for you. It has a 2.5-horsepower motor that can reach speeds up to 7.6 miles per hour which is plenty of power to run or walk. This model comes with an automatic incline feature which can raise your feet to nine percent. It's perfect for adding some intensity to your walks. It can be used with an app for your smartphone, which lets you to monitor your progress and see the number of calories you've consumed.

    The UREVO treadmill under your desk is also compact and quiet, making it easy to use. It has a small footprint and folds down when it's not in use, so you can put it under your desk or even under the couch when you're not making use of it. It is easy to set-up and has an LCD screen that can show your speed, distance and calories burned. It comes with Bluetooth speakers so you can enjoy your favorite songs while you work. GGR staff writer Lauren Strong used this treadmill in her office at home for a couple of weeks, but hasn't heard of it in Zoom meetings.

    Another crucial aspect to consider when purchasing an under-desk treadmill with incline uk is the capacity for weight. Most of the treadmills that we tested can support 220 pounds. This is enough for the majority of people. If you weigh more than that, you'll want to choose the treadmill with a larger weight capacity. This will help the treadmill last longer and stop it from being damaged due to excessive pressure on the motor.
